Romans 6:8
8Now if we be dead with Christ, we believe that we shall also live with him:
8Now if we be dead with Christ, we beleeue that we shal also liue with him:
Romans 6:9
9Knowing that Christ being raised from the dead dieth no more; death hath no more dominion over him.
9Knowing that Christ being raysed from the dead, dieth no more, death hath no more dominion ouer him.
